
Continence Awareness/Stoma Care
Course Outline
To discuss the underpinning knowledge of the urinary and faecal systems. To discuss continence aids. To discuss urinary catheters and the care of equipment. To understand pra-pubic catheters. To understand the uses of urostomys, ileostomys and colostomys. To discuss how to promote continence. To discuss abnormalities.
Who is the course aimed at?
This course is develped for care staff and support workers to raise their awareness of the causes of incontinence, the use of continence aids, promotion of good practice, and the care of individuals with catheters.
How long is the course?
Half day
What will you learn?
– To gain an understanding of continence care
– To be able to perform care tasks involving continence care
